Tips to reduce midnight trips to the washroom
Waking up in the night to urinate - called nocturia - can interrupt deep sleep, leave you feeling groggy the next day, and over time, could even impact your memory and mood.
Fortunately, there are several practical strategies that can reduce nocturia and improve sleep quality.
